How Delivery Management System Works: A Complete Guide
Published on 4/28/2026

As the market is becoming hypercompetitive and focusing on elevating the convenience of customers, delivery is not just a normal operation. Every day, businesses are putting efforts into improving their delivery system, whether it is B2B, B2C, or D2C. By improving the shipment cycle, it not only improves satisfaction but also builds trust and relationships with customers, which leads to a better retention rate. Here comes the improvement of the delivery management system, which simplifies the shipment or delivery cycle overall.
A well-equipped DMS not only manages the shipment but also helps in reducing the cost, improving customer satisfaction, and enabling businesses to scale more quickly and smartly. Therefore, it becomes pivotal to find the best delivery management software that elevates the entire delivery cycle. Through this blog, we will come to know about the importance, framework, and best delivery management software.
What is a Delivery Management System?
A delivery management system is an advanced platform for businesses to improve overall shipment, which helps in managing, tracking, and optimizing the entire process from start to end.
It acts as a centralized platform that connects:
- Orders
- Dispatch teams
- Delivery agents
- Customers
Therefore, a delivery management system elevates real-time tracking and leads to intelligent decision-making operations.
Understand The Comprehensive Work Process of the Delivery Management System
Before incorporating the delivery management system, it is necessary to understand its entire working process.
1. Order Capture and Integration
The process begins when an order is placed through:
- eCommerce websites
- Mobile apps
- POS systems
- Call centers
The DMS integrates with these platforms and automatically captures:
- Customer details
- Delivery address
- Product information
- Delivery time preferences
Why This Step Matters:
- Eliminates manual data entry
- Reduces errors
- Speeds up order processing
2. Order Validation and Prioritization
Before dispatch, the system validates:
- Address accuracy
- Service availability
- Delivery timelines
Once the process is done, the next part is to prioritize
- Urgency of delivery, either the next day or same-day delivery
- Customer type (premium vs regular)
- Delivery location
3. Intelligent Order Assignment
Once validated, the DMS assigns orders to delivery agents using smart algorithms.
Factors Considered:
- Driver’s current location
- Vehicle capacity
- Traffic conditions
- Delivery deadlines
- Driver performance history
Result:
- Faster assignment
- Reduced idle time
- Balanced workload distribution
4. Route Optimization (Core Engine of DMS)
In the entire process, the route optimization step is very crucial to calculate the efficient route for delivery.
This process is done by using
- Real-time traffic data
- Distance between stops
- Delivery time windows
- Road conditions
Key Outcomes:
- Reduced fuel consumption
- Faster deliveries
- Increased number of deliveries per trip
This is especially critical for businesses handling multiple deliveries in a single route (last-mile delivery).
5. Dispatch and Driver Communication
Once the route optimization is done, the software automatically fetches the delivery instructions provided to the drivers through the specified mobile app.
Driver App Features:
- Provides you with appropriate and precise navigation
- Delivery sequence
- Customer contact details
- Real-time updates
Drivers can:
- Accept/reject tasks
- Update delivery status
- Report issues
Impact:
- Smooth coordination
- Reduced confusion
- Improved delivery accuracy
6. Real-Time Tracking and Visibility
A modern DMS offers live tracking capabilities for both businesses and customers.
Features Include:
- GPS tracking of delivery vehicles
- Estimated Time of Arrival (ETA)
- Delivery status updates
Customers receive notifications like:
- “Out for delivery.”
- “Arriving soon”
- “Delivered successfully”
Benefits:
- Builds customer trust
- Reduces support queries
- Improves transparency
7. Proper Completion of Delivery
The delivery agent follows the optimized route and completes the delivery.
The system ensures:
- Timely arrival
- Accurate delivery
- Customer communication
8. Proof of Delivery (POD)
After the delivery is done, the system automatically fetches the details and captures digital proof of the delivery completion.
Common POD Methods:
- OTP verification
- E-signature
- Photo confirmation
Importance:
- Prevents disputes
- Ensures accountability
- Provides legal proof
9. Analytics, Insights, and Reporting
After deliveries are completed, the DMS generates detailed reports.
Key Metrics:
- Delivery success rate
- Average delivery time
- Driver performance
- Cost per delivery
Business Impact:
- Data-driven decision making
- Continuous improvement
- Better planning and forecasting
Understand the Importance of the Delivery Management System
As we all know, delivery management software is created to simplify and automate the whole shipment and supply chain process. However, it has other benefits such as:
1. Enhances Operational Efficiency: Automation replaces manual processes, reducing errors and saving time. Businesses can handle higher delivery volumes with fewer resources.
2. Improves Delivery Speed. With optimized routing and smart dispatching, deliveries become significantly faster, helping meet same-day and instant delivery demands.
3. Reduces Operational Costs: Proper implementation of DMS reduces other costs like fuel expenses, failed deliveries, and labor costs. This augments the
4. Boosts Customer Satisfaction: By improving the timely delivery and real-time tracking improves the retention rates and brand reputation.
5. Enables Scalability: A shipment management system allows businesses to scale faster and improve the efficiency of their operations.
Which is the Best Delivery or Shipment Management Software?
Businesses looking for the top quality, cutting-edge, and reliable shipment management system, then Cognilix is the right platform to partner with. Cognilix works on modern technology to elevate the B2B delivery management system with the integration of AI. It helps businesses to streamline their entire supply chain and shipment process and includes features like managing orders, tracking drivers, and even analyzing with real-time tracking.
Key Features of Cognilix
- Smart Order Management
- AI-Based Route Optimization
- Real-Time Tracking
- Automated Dispatching
- Driver Management
- Proof of Delivery (POD)
- Advanced Analytics
Key Features to Look for in Delivery Management Software
When selecting a DMS, ensure it includes:
- Automated dispatching
- AI-powered route optimization
- Real-time GPS tracking
- Mobile app for drivers
- Multi-delivery handling
- Integration with eCommerce platforms
- Delivery scheduling
- Analytics dashboard
- API integrations
Conclusion
The delivery of products at the right time helps businesses to improve their brand trust, customer satisfaction, and retain users effortlessly. Therefore, opting for a smart and AI-powered delivery or shipment management system becomes necessary to stay ahead of competitors. Cognilix is India's best SaaS B2B solution offering a wide range of cutting-edge and AI powered platform, such as vendor management. So, build a powerful supply chain ecosystem and improve the shopping experience of your customers.


